๐Ÿ“œ Historical events on this date

1122
Concordat of Worms agreed between Pope Calixtus II and Holy Roman Emperor Henry V.

1821
Fall of Tripolitsa, Greek forces massacre 30,000 Turks during Greek War of Independence.

1884
American Herman Hollerith patents his mechanical tabulating machine, the beginning of data processing.

1889
Nintendo Koppai (Later Nintendo Company, Limited) founded by Fusajiro Yamauchi to produce and market the playing card game Hanafuda.

1942
The'Manhattan Project' commences, under the direction of US General Leslie Groves: its aim - to deliver an atomic bomb.

2018
Indian Prime Minister Narendra Modi launches "Modicare", free heathcare for 500 million, world's biggest healthcare program.

๐Ÿ† Sports in 1988

๐Ÿ’ NHL
Edmonton Oilers defeated Boston Bruins (4 - 0) to win the 1988 Stanley Cup.

๐Ÿˆ NFL
Washington Redskins beat Denver Broncos (42 - 10) to win Super Bowl XXII on January 31, 1988 in San Diego, CA.

โšพ MLB
Los Angeles Dodgers beat Oakland Athletics (4 - 1) to win the 1988 World Series.

๐ŸŽพ Tennis
In the 1988 US Open Championships, Mats Wilander defeated Ivan Lendl (6-4, 4-6, 6-3, 5-7, 6-4) to win the men's singles title. Steffi Graf beat Gabriela Sabatini (6-3, 3-6, 6-1) to become the Wimbledon women's singles champion.
